Various types of roofing materials on commercial buildings require distinct approaches to maintenance and repair. For instance, the flat roofs that are so commonly seen on commercial buildings might suffer from ponding water, which, if not fixed right away, can lead to seriously damaging leaks. On the other hand, metal roofs, so admired for their durability, might need occasional repairs to stay in top shape, since corrosion can occur over time. Neither of these types of roofs is infallible, but both can last a long time with the right commercial roof repair team on your side.
Environmental and climate factors influence the types of repairs that commercial roofs in Sunrise Manor may need. Intense sunshine can contribute to the deterioration of roofing materials, while our sudden storms can inflict damage (wind uplift or punctures) that can necessitate... inspections, repairs, and some maintenance agreements. If your commercial roof has any additional equipment on it (like an HVAC system), care should be taken to ensure the condition of the roof—because that equipment can exacerbate vulnerabilities.
